How do I use arrays in cURL POST requests

You are just creating your array incorrectly. You could use http_build_query:

$fields = array(
            'username' => "annonymous",
            'api_key' => urlencode("1234"),
            'images' => array(
                 urlencode(base64_encode('image1')),
                 urlencode(base64_encode('image2'))
            )
        );
$fields_string = http_build_query($fields);

So, the entire code that you could use would be:

<?php
//extract data from the post
extract($_POST);

//set POST variables
$url="http://api.example.com/api";
$fields = array(
            'username' => "annonymous",
            'api_key' => urlencode("1234"),
            'images' => array(
                 urlencode(base64_encode('image1')),
                 urlencode(base64_encode('image2'))
            )
        );

//url-ify the data for the POST
$fields_string = http_build_query($fields);

//open connection
$ch = curl_init();

//set the url, number of POST vars, POST data
curl_setopt($ch,CURLOPT_URL, $url);
curl_setopt($ch,CURLOPT_POST, 1);
curl_setopt($ch,CURLOPT_POSTFIELDS, $fields_string);

//execute post
$result = curl_exec($ch);
echo $result;

//close connection
curl_close($ch);
?>
